在現代web開發中,前端變得越來越重要。為了更好的開發體驗和良好的用戶界面,很多web開發者需要使用各種框架和庫。在這些框架中,Vue.js已經成為非常流行的選擇,同時Electron.js也被越來越多地用于構建跨平臺本地應用程序。這兩個框架的結合,產生了一個強大的工具,即Electron.js-Vue。
Electron.js-Vue將Vue.js和Electron.js結合在一起,使得開發人員能夠更加輕松地創建本地應用程序。Vue.js提供了易于使用的用戶界面和組件,并且能夠良好地與Electron.js集成。Electron.js則提供了訪問本地功能的能力及允許開發者在多種操作系統上構建本地應用程序的優勢。
在使用Electron.js-Vue的過程中,你可以像使用普通的Vue.js應用程序一樣,方便地創建組件和模板,但是同時,你還可以訪問Electron.js提供的本地功能,例如文件訪問和系統對話框等。
import { app, BrowserWindow } from 'electron' import Vue from 'vue' let win; function createWindow() { // 創建瀏覽器窗口 win = new BrowserWindow({ width: 800, height: 600 }) // 加載index.html文件 win.loadFile('index.html') } app.on('ready', () =>{ createWindow() // 創建一個 Vue 實例 new Vue({ el: '#app', data: { message: 'Hello Vue!' } }) })
值得注意的是,在使用Electron.js-Vue時,你需要遵循一些最佳實踐,以確保你的代碼在各種操作系統上都能正常工作。例如,你需要避免使用本地文件路徑,以免在Windows或MacOS上出現問題。除此之外,如果你想使你的應用程序更穩定,你也需要注意處理錯誤和異常情況。
總而言之,Electron.js-Vue是一種非常有用的工具,可以讓你更加輕松地創建跨平臺的本地應用程序。結合Vue.js和Electron.js的優點,使用Electron.js-Vue可以讓你在開發本地應用程序時減少很多工作,并且能夠讓你的應用程序更加易于維護和開發。
上一篇Css兩列左邊不動